In this episode, inspiring actor Becki Dennis takes us on her journey from Boston to Los Angeles. If you are an actor that has doubts or have been told you have no chance because you are not a size 0, this episode is for you!

Becki Dennis has most recently appeared on THIS IS US, SPEECHLESS and THE YOUNG AND THE RESTLESS. To learn more about Becki Dennis please visit: imdb.me/beckidennis

In this episode, Los Angeles Independent casting director Jeannine Fisher talks about:

  • what filmmakers need to prep before approaching a casting director
  • what actors need to do to put their best foot forward
  • how we as artists can change the perception of artists of color

and so much more!

In this episode, award winning actor and filmmaker Don Wallace walks us through his journey of creating, financing, and getting distribution for his first feature film.

If you are in the mood to get inspired, this episode is for you!

In this episode, Award Winning Writer/Director/Producer Linda Palmer talks about the importance of production design, how she started producing out of the necessity to see her own scripts get made, how to hire your post production crew and so much more! Part 1 of 2.

This is an introduction episode 000 with Angela Matemotja.

MISSION:

A podcast where filmmakers, actors and screenwriters that are passionate about creating socially conscious content, learn, inspire and get motivated! OUR FOCUS: 1. To Shine a spotlight on Creators of Color, Women and all under- represented artists. 2. To teach, motivate and inspire independent filmmakers, actors and screenwriters that are committed to creating content with a conscious.   3. To learn from industry experts how to create, produce and market our projects so we can get them out into the world. Let's build a tribe of artists that support and inspire one another by sharing our stories, educating ourselves and helping each other get our socially conscious projects out into the world.

Master acting teacher and legendary actor Richard Lawson discusses the importance of telling our stories, giving back and how to maintain an acting/filmmaking career on your own terms. Stop Waiting Start Creating!
